A key word for customer alignment

One of the key words that is vital to successfully building customer alignment is “Trust”. In order to create the type of customer alignment that leads to long lasting mutually beneficial relationships, customers will need to:

– Trust that you are equally focused on their best interests as well as yours.
– Trust that you are building a relationship for the long-term and not just for short-term gains.
– Trust that your product or service will do what you said that it will do.
– Trust that before making any major product decisions, you will solicit input from them or others within their industry.
– Trust that your support will be there when they need it.
– Trust that the feedback and input that they offer gets considered even though it may not always be used.
– Trust that you will continue to focus on building solutions that meet their needs as well as others within their industry.
– Trust that the confidential information remains confidential.
– Trust that any referrals that they offer will be treated with the same level of service as they receive.
